企业版小程序会员系统开发解决方案
一、项目背景与目标
随着移动互联网的普及,越来越多的企业开始利用小程序进行品牌推广和业务拓展。为了提高用户粘性,增加企业收益,企业需要开发一个功能完善、操作便捷的会员系统。本方案旨在为企业提供一个全面、可执行的小程序会员系统开发解决方案。
二、需求分析
1. 用户管理:包括会员注册、登录、信息修改等功能。
2. 会员等级:根据会员消费金额、积分等指标设定不同等级,享受不同权益。
3. 会员权益:包括优惠券、积分兑换、生日福利等。
4. 数据统计:实时统计会员消费、积分等信息,方便企业进行数据分析和决策。
5. 客服支持:提供在线客服功能,解答会员疑问,处理投诉等。
三、技术选型
1. 前端:采用微信小程序框架,使用WXML、WXSS、JavaScript等技术实现界面展示和交互。
2. 后端:采用云开发平台(如腾讯云、阿里云等),使用Node.js、Python等语言开发API接口。
3. 数据库:采用MySQL或MongoDB存储会员数据、订单信息等。
4. 服务器:采用Nginx或Apache作为HTTP服务器,Tomcat或Jetty作为Web服务器。
四、功能模块设计
1. 用户管理模块:实现会员注册、登录、信息修改等功能。
2. 会员等级模块:根据会员消费金额、积分等指标设定不同等级,享受不同权益。
3. 会员权益模块:包括优惠券、积分兑换、生日福利等。
4. 数据统计模块:实时统计会员消费、积分等信息,方便企业进行数据分析和决策。
5. 客服支持模块:提供在线客服功能,解答会员疑问,处理投诉等。
五、开发流程
1. 需求分析:与业务部门沟通,明确系统功能和要求。
2. 技术选型:选择合适的技术栈和工具。
3. 功能模块设计:按照功能模块划分任务,分配给开发人员。
4. 编码实现:按照设计文档编写代码,进行单元测试和集成测试。
5. 部署上线:将代码部署到服务器上,进行性能优化和安全防护。
6. 测试验收:邀请业务部门参与测试,确保系统满足需求。
7. 上线运营:正式上线后,持续监控系统运行情况,及时修复问题。
六、安全与维护
1. 数据安全:对敏感数据进行加密存储,防止泄露。
2. 系统安全:定期更新系统补丁,防范黑客攻击。
3. 运维支持:建立完善的运维体系,确保系统稳定运行。
七、总结
本方案为企业提供了一个全面的小程序会员系统开发解决方案,从需求分析到开发流程再到安全维护,每个环节都有详细的指导和建议。通过实施本方案,企业可以打造一个功能强大、用户体验良好的会员系统,提高用户粘性,增加企业收益。